根据SSH 协议,每次登陆必须输入密码,比较麻烦,SSH还提供了公钥登陆,可以省去输入密码的步骤。 公钥登陆:用户将自己的公钥存储在远程主机上,登陆的时候,远程主机会向用户发送一串随机字符串,用户用自己的私钥加密后,再发回来。 远程主机用事先储存的公钥进行揭秘,如果成功,证明用户可信,直接允许 ...
刚装玩fedora,那么我们就以fedora为例来说一下怎么配置: 先确认是否已安装ssh服务: root localhost rpm qa grepopenssh server openssh server . p .fc .i 这行表示已安装 若未安装ssh服务,可输入: yuminstallopenssh server 进行安装 winscp登陆,用root密码登陆。 修改配置文件: vi ...
2018-01-06 10:46 1 2631 推荐指数:
根据SSH 协议,每次登陆必须输入密码,比较麻烦,SSH还提供了公钥登陆,可以省去输入密码的步骤。 公钥登陆:用户将自己的公钥存储在远程主机上,登陆的时候,远程主机会向用户发送一串随机字符串,用户用自己的私钥加密后,再发回来。 远程主机用事先储存的公钥进行揭秘,如果成功,证明用户可信,直接允许 ...
1. 客户端生成公钥文件 会生成id_rsa和id_rsa.pub文件,前者是私钥,后者是需要上传到服务器的公钥 2.把公钥放到服务器上 使用scp简单方便 3.修改sshd的配置(/etc/ssh/sshd_config) 找到以下内容,并去掉注释符”#“ 配置 ...
ssh免密码登录,折腾了我一天~~~,如果用root权限的话挺简单的,但是这样着实有些不正规,毕竟我是专业的好伐~~ 所以带来了很多奇怪的问题,当解决了的时候发现,其实也没那么麻烦。 以下是我最开始用root用户做的117单向无密码连接到118,119,120。这个是构建 ...
服务器A需要传输文件至B:即A生成密钥,B保存密钥 1.A服务器生成密钥,一般已有生成密钥,若无,ssh-keygen -t rsa 2.scp .ssh/id_rsa.pub root@192.168.0.2:/root/.ssh/authorized_keys (输入B服务器密码 ...
文件 5.用secureCRT或者ssh通过私钥连接验证,验证正常登陆即可 6.关闭密码 ...
平时工作学习必须要使用Windows,在SSH远程连接软件里Putty算是用得比较顺手的,而且很小巧。 但是每次输入密码很麻烦,还容易输错,OpenSSH可以利用密钥来自动登陆,如此一来方便了不少。配置过程分为三步: 1、生成公钥和私钥 先要下载一个叫puttygen的软件(下载见附件 ...
公司为了安全,一直都采用PublicKey文件的方式登陆远程SSH,现在有了自己的服务器,自己又学者配了一把,下面就是配置笔记。 生成DSA类型的PublicKey文件Linux: ssh-keygen -t dsaWindows: SecurCRT 将生成的.pub公钥文件拷贝到~/.ssh ...
问题 在 gitlab 里已经配置里 ssh-keys,但是使用 ssh clone 项目的时候需要如下一样的输入密码,而且无论输入什么都不对导致无法 clone 项目。 解决办法 一. 使用 http 方式 clone 这个办法就是快速解决 clone 项目的,直接使用 git ...